"What do we do now?" Portlyn asked, dusting herself off and checking her nails. "We have nowhere to go, no way to survive, we can't do anything!"
Sonny and Chad both looked around, finding a safe looking rock to sit on. Unfortunately for them, their rocks were both the same. The two attempted to sit on it, but it wasn't large enough for the two. "Get off!" Sonny yelled at the boy. "I saw it first! This rock is mine."
"No!" He responded smugly. "The rock is mine." He gazed into her eyes with a kind expression on his face, causing the brunette to forget what she was doing for a moment. He took this time to attempt to steal the rock from under her.
She then realized what was going on, and made a fuss attempting to get the rock back. "Hey! You can't do that!" She screamed at him. Running back to it, the girl grabbed his arms and attempted to push him off. Chad couldn't help but notice that he felt a tingle in his arm, like whenever else she did such. The blonde looked over at the arm, giving Sonny enough of a chance to push him slightly off and take the seat.
The rest of the fight was a jumble of yelling, "It's mine!" or screaming, "Give it back!" like two children. The argument ended when the two bumped heads. They looked up at each other, blushed, then looked up at the rest of the group who had begun to laugh at their childish endeavors to get a silly rock.
Sonny then took this time to get back to her throne when she noticed writing on it. "Hey guys! There's something on this!" She called out to them. The brunette curiously looked at it and read what was on it aloud.
The fortune of your future awaits,
After these deadly coming fates.
The triumph of these events shall not last,
For someone will end it before it has past.
This story shows itself to only you,
It will give you instructions on what you must do.
It all started in downtown of a famous place,
Where millions of stars have shown their face.
"What a stupid rhyme." A Meal or No Meal girl said, laughing.
Chad looked back at the rock, curiously. "I think we should follow it. I mean, it's better than sitting around pouting about our possible death." The rest of the group looked at him, shocked. At first, he was the most skeptic of the event. Now he wanted to follow something to stop it? "It is what Mr. Condor wanted us to do. Maybe he was right! The entire world is being engulfed by storms. Some of our friends just got killed. The least we can do is go see what this stupid rock is talking about."
"It'll be fun!" Sonny announced. "It'll be like a scavenger hunt. Maybe there'll be Cocoa Mocha Cocoa." Tawni and Portlyn looked at each other, excited.
"We're in!" They said in unison.
Nico looked skeptical. "What if it's a trap? Or what if it's just too dangerous? Downtown probably isn't the safest place to be during all theseā¦" The rumbling of the ground shook the group, and stopped the fedora wearing dude from what he was saying. It stopped quickly, but the small earthquake frightened everybody. "Earthquakes and storms." He finished.
Zora then chimed in. "I think we should do it. There's no reason why we can't."
Nico sighed, knowing he was defeated. Chloe stood up. "So it's settled! We'll all go on the treasure hunt to find the Cocoa Mocha Cocoa!"
"Let's get moving!" Portlyn yelled.

The trek back to the city was getting harder. The storm clouds flowed into the sky like milk, and trees swayed like Hula dancers. "I'll keep on checking the weather on my Smartphone as we go along." A teen gladiator volunteered. No one objected to that. They were all getting more and more frightened; thunderstorms would quickly run by them and occasionally the ground would rumble.
"When will we get there?" Julia, a Meal or No Meal girl complained. "My feet are tired and I don't want to get my new sweatpants dirty." Everyone groaned. They were sick of her constant complaining. It gets tiring after a while, and soon enough you'd just love to punch them.
Suddenly, Nico yelled out, "Where's Grady?" The group stopped.
"What do you mean, weren't you walking with him?" Joey, one of the smaller teen gladiators asked.
"W-w-well, I was." Nico stuttered, shocked by the realization his best friend was gone. "But we didn't talk for about five minutes, because we were trying to keep up. I turned around to ask him a question and he was gone! I think I lost him."
"How do you lose a person?" Chad asked.
Sonny cut the boys off. "Let's go find him before it's too late! Everyone spread out. Stick with your cast and we'll meet back here." The four remaining groups did as told. So Random spread out back in the direction they came.
"We better find him!" Zora told her group. She began to run, and everyone else did too.
"Grady! Grady! Where did you go?" They screamed at the top of their lungs, still running back to where they last saw him. Tawni tripped over a branch and fell sideways into a bush. They didn't notice until they heard her scream.
Sonny sighed. "Great, we lost Tawni now too."
"I told you it was easy to lose a person." Nico argued.
They backtracked until they found Tawni curled up on the ground, tears forming in her eyes. "I found Grady." She mumbled, and pointed into the bushes.
The blonde was in fact there, sputtering for air. "Grady!" Nico cried out, lying at his friend's side. "Stay with me buddy!" He pleaded, but it was too late. He took his last breath, and then all went still. His eyes became dull and lifeless, and when Sonny checked his pulse, there was none. Tears filled the remaining cast member's eyes. Zora picked up her cell phone and dialed the rest of the groups.
"Yes, we found him." She said into her phone sadly. "Uh-huh, we'll see you back there. Okay, bye."
Not too long later, the So Random group had finished dragging Grady's body into the clearing where the rest of the groups stood. A hush fell over the crowd, followed by multiple gasps.
"What happened?" Devon asked. "He was with us practically the entire time! A storm couldn't have killed him."
"We found that out too." Zora replied, showing the body to everyone to reveal two gunshot wounds in his chest, as well as another two in his back. "Somehow, he was murdered."
